Latest Patents
Yap Han Ng holds a patent for a disk drive performing a spiral scan of the disk surface to detect residual data. This invention involves a disk drive that comprises a disk surface with a radius, a head capable of generating a read signal, and a voice coil motor (VCM) that actuates the head over the disk surface. The VCM measures a back electromotive force (BEMF) voltage, which is used to control the movement of the head across the entire radius of the disk surface. While the head is in motion, the read signal is processed to detect any residual data that may remain on the disk surface after it has been erased.
